Gathering Your Ingredients
Before you start, let’s make sure we have everything laid out. Here’s what you’ll need for these scrumptious Chocolate Chip Pecan Pie Bars:
For the Crust:
- 1 cup all-purpose flour
- 1/4 cup brown sugar
- 1/2 cup unsalted butter, softened (because no one likes hard butter)
- 1/4 teaspoon salt
For the Filling:
- 1 cup corn syrup
- 1/2 cup granulated sugar
- 1/2 cup brown sugar
- 4 large eggs
- 1 teaspoon vanilla extract
- 1 1/2 cups chopped pecans
- 1 cup chocolate chips (or a little more if youโre feeling bold)

Consider preheating your oven to 350ยฐF (175ยฐC) now. This is one of those things you can do to make your life easier. Trust me, no one wants to forget to preheat and get stuck staring at raw batter for 30 minutes. ๐ฌ
Letโs Get Mixing!
Now itโs time to put it all together. Grab your mixing bowls and get ready to create something magical.
Step 1: Prepare the Crust
- Mix Ingredients: In a bowl, combine the flour, brown sugar, and salt. Add the butter and mix until it looks like coarse crumbs. You can use a fork or your handsโฆ whatever speaks to you.
- Press It In: Press the mixture into the bottom of a greased 9×9-inch baking pan. Make it nice and even; this is your dessertโs foundation! Bake for about 10-12 minutes until itโs lightly golden.
Step 2: Create the Filling
- Mix the Sugars: In another bowl, whisk together the corn syrup, granulated sugar, and brown sugar until smooth.
- Add Eggs and Vanilla: Beat in the eggs and vanilla extract until combinedโthis is where the magic starts to happen!
- Stir in the Good Stuff: Fold in the chopped pecans and chocolate chips.
Step 3: Assemble
- Pour the Filling: Once your crust has baked, pour the filling mixture over the hot crust. No need to let it cool; we want to take advantage of that warm base!
- Bake Again: Pop it back into the oven for another 30-35 minutes, or until the filling is set. You might want to give it a little jiggle test. If itโs not jiggling like Jell-O, youโre good to go.
Step 4: Cool Down
Let these bars cool completely in the pan before cutting into squares. I know, waiting is the hardest part, but trust me, it’s worth it. You donโt want to end up with gooey messes, right?
A Few Tips for Maximum Deliciousness
- Storage: Store these bars in an airtight container. Theyโll stay fresh for about 4-5 days, if you can resist eating them all at once (good luck with that).
- Serving Suggestions: Serve them plain or with a scoop of vanilla ice cream. Because why not take it over the top?
- Feel Free to Improvise: Want to sprinkle some flaky sea salt on top? Go wild! IMO, it takes these bars to the next level. ๐
Frequently Asked Questions
Q: Can I use other types of nuts?
A: Absolutely! If youโre not a big fan of pecans, walnuts or almonds work too. Or skip the nuts altogether if you want to!
Q: What can I use instead of corn syrup?
A: You can use maple syrup or honey, but keep in mind it may change the flavor profile a bit. Not necessarily a bad thing!
Q: Can I freeze these bars?
A: Yup! Just wrap them well and pop them in the freezer. They may lose a bit of their texture, so consider thawing them in the fridge before enjoying.

Chocolate Chip Pecan Pie Bars
- Total Time: 60 minutes
- Yield: 16 servings 1x
- Diet: Vegetarian
Description
These delightful bars combine the sweet richness of pecan pie with gooey chocolate chips for a treat that will impress everyone.
Ingredients
- 1 cup all-purpose flour
- 1/4 cup brown sugar
- 1/2 cup unsalted butter, softened
- 1/4 teaspoon salt
- 1 cup corn syrup
- 1/2 cup granulated sugar
- 1/2 cup brown sugar
- 4 large eggs
- 1 teaspoon vanilla extract
- 1 1/2 cups chopped pecans
- 1 cup chocolate chips
Instructions
- Preheat your oven to 350ยฐF (175ยฐC).
- In a bowl, combine flour, brown sugar, and salt. Add butter and mix until it resembles coarse crumbs.
- Press the mixture evenly into the bottom of a greased 9×9-inch baking pan and bake for 10-12 minutes until lightly golden.
- In another bowl, whisk together corn syrup, granulated sugar, and brown sugar until smooth.
- Beat in eggs and vanilla extract until combined.
- Fold in chopped pecans and chocolate chips.
- Pour the filling over the hot crust and return it to the oven for another 30-35 minutes until set.
- Allow the bars to cool completely in the pan before cutting into squares.
Notes
Store in an airtight container for up to 4-5 days. Serve with vanilla ice cream for an extra treat.
